I’ve been working at Unity for almost a year now, and one of the special events that the company hosts every year is Hackweek. During this annual 1 week event, most of the employees get the opportunity to work on a special innovative project of their choice, or spend the week in a Unity Bootcamp, learning how to use this amazing video game tool that so many great video games utilize for their success. I chose the latter, and built my first game.

It’s called Metal Gear Billy, and is hosted on itch.io. There’s a link to the game below. I wanted to focus on 2D, and to learn deep skills like tilemap, lighting, collisions and menus. I wanted the game to feel polished, even though it’s far from complete. I feel I succeeded, and I will be looking forward to building on these skills when I take on more projects and game jams (I’m going to take on the GMTK game jam coming up soon).
